Requirements
An appropriate Bachelor’s Degree in Public Administration / Management at NQF level 7 or related fields including Commerce / Public Policy / Regional, Urban Planning / Development Studies recognized by SAQA. A minimum of 5 years’ relevant experience at middle / senior managerial level within the related field. Successful completion of the Senior Management Pre-entry Programme as endorsed by the National School of Government (NSG) must be submitted prior to appointment. Furthermore, all shortlisted candidates, including the SMS, shall undertake two pre-entry assessments. One will be a practical exercise to determine a candidate’s suitability based on the post’s technical and generic requirements and the other must be an integrity (ethical conduct) assessment. Experience in the M&E, Policy and planning and Research field would be an added advantage. Knowledge and skills: Knowledge of data collection processes, including data analysis and information management. Computer literacy especially in Microsoft Windows Suite e.g. MS Word, Excel and Outlook. Experience of planning and organizing, interpersonal and communication skills. Problem solving and capability in decision-making. Team leadership, customer service orientation. Maintain confidentiality and ability to work under pressure. Knowledge of the Constitution of the Republic of South Africa, Government legislative framework, and an understanding of all relevant legislation and regulations that govern the Public Service including Public Finance Management Act (PFMA) and treasury regulations, Public Service Act, Labour Relations Act etc. Knowledge of National Framework of Strategic Plans and Annual Performance Plans, National Development Plan, Medium-Term Strategic Framework, Operations Management Framework, Provincial Growth and Development Plan, District Growth and Development Plan. Human Resources Development theory and practice. Stakeholder management and coordination, strategic thinking, leadership and negotiation. Understanding of the Batho Pele principles. Knowledge of diversity management, communication and information management. Knowledge and understanding of Public Service Policies.
Duties
Facilitate and coordinate operational and strategic planning process. Coordinate the compilation of strategic and operational plans. Set research agenda, provide policy support, development process and maintain the repository thereof. Facilitate knowledge and learning management process. Facilitate the development and implementation of service delivery improvement plans and initiatives. Facilitate, coordinate and support the implementation of priority programmes/projects. Conduct institutional performance assessment and evaluation of the implementation of policies, programmes and systems. Coordinate and oversee compilation of institutional performance and strategic reports. Conduct an assessment of the department’s effectiveness and efficiency in supporting the attainment of service delivery objectives. Facilitate the implementation of productivity measurement framework. Design and implement change management initiatives. Facilitate the implementation of diversity management programmes. Provide customer relations and frontline improvement services. Facilitate and coordinate the implementation of service delivery improvement programmes and interventions. Provide information communication technology business enablement and governance services. Provide infrastructure and operations support services. Provide ICT Planning, Alignment, Programme Management and M&E. Provide ICT operations, solutions and support systems. The provision of Information and Knowledge Management services. Provide internal communication services. Provide content management and media liaising support services. Provide public liaison and events management services. Provide external communication services. Provide language management services in terms of Language Act of 2012. Provide physical security services. Provide security control services. Facilitation of staff vetting in terms of security clearance. Coordination of office space. Facilitate infrastructure maintenance. Facilitate the provision of refectory/canteen services. Provide cleaning services. Provide messenger and transport services. Provide records management services.
